    State Sen. Carlos Uresti, a San Antonio Democrat, announced he will resign from office effective Thursday. He was convicted by a federal jury on 11 felony charges in February... Four months after his felony conviction, state Sen. Carlos Uresti announced today he will step down from office effective Thursday. Uresti is scheduled to be sentenced June 26 after being found guilty in February by a federal jury on 11 felony charges in connection with his involvement in a now-defunct San Antonio oilfield-services company that defrauded investors. The San Antonio Democrat has indicated he will appeal his conviction.

    SAN ANTONIO — The courtroom was silent and thick with anxiety Thursday morning as the judge’s deputy read the verdicts: “Guilty,” “guilty,” “guilty” — 11 times over, and on all felony counts. State Sen. Carlos Uresti sat stone-faced, his gaze directed at the deputy, as he heard the ruling that throws into question his two-decade career in the Texas Legislature and opens up the possibility of years in federal prison and millions in fines.

    FBI and IRS agents today conducted an operation at the law office of State Senator Carlos Uresti, News Radio 1200 WOAI reports. The operation took place at Uresti's private law office on Quincy Street, just off I-35 on the north end of downtown.An FBI agent confirmed only that agents are conducting 'lawful law enforcement activity' at the office. They are being assisted by San Antonio Police, officers are keeping bystanders at bay.It is not clear what the agents are looking for. The IRS has not returned a call seeking comment. Developing
